Full description

This is a vehicle dataset for vision-based place recognition with manually ground truthed frame correspondences. The dataset was captured in two different conditions for the same route: one on a sunny day and one during a rainy night. Both datasets were taken in the suburb of Alderley, Queensland.

The dataset contains original .avi movie files as well as individual frames extracted from the video and compressed into zip files. A .csv file holds the frame correspondences, which is replicated in the MATLAB mat file (requires MATLAB to use). The frame correspondences can be visually validated using the MATLAB script PLAYBACK.m. This will play back the videos, aligned using the frame correspondences in fm.mat.

FRAMESA corresponds to the night time traverse and FRAMESB to the day time traverse.

Data time period: 08 2011 to 31 08 2011
